Licensing & Certifications
At My Good Movers, we believe peace of mind starts with verified credentials. Nationwide Van Lines holds all required registrations to legally operate both local and interstate moves.
US DOT:
US DOT 976593 —
This DOT number, issued by the FMCSA, confirms the mover meets federal safety and
insurance requirements for interstate moves.
MC Number:
ICC MC 411705
— This number confirms the mover is authorized to transport household goods across
state lines.

Nationwide Van Lines calculates your moving cost based on several factors, including the distance, total weight or volume of items, and any additional services requested (e.g., packing or storage). Some moves are priced hourly (local), while others are flat-rate or weight-based estimates (long-distance).

When choosing a moving company in Florida, start by checking if the company is properly licensed and insured for operations in that state. Look for verified customer reviews and transparent pricing. It’s also helpful to compare at least 2–3 movers in Florida to evaluate their reliability and experience.
